Output e250c5583900259deb96ef13f1d3ee559b671c15477179db61e9d0e26f2e1d2a:10

value
17441300
script pubkey
OP_0 OP_PUSHBYTES_32 b21d093a5d29628dc2d6f20209217952054d30fc5bff0201b69bf78907183015
address
bc1qkgwsjwja993gmskk7gpqjgte2gz56v8ut0lsyqdkn0mcjpccxq2sdhkf8u
transaction
e250c5583900259deb96ef13f1d3ee559b671c15477179db61e9d0e26f2e1d2a